Session-token refresh bug (a.k.a. the "zombie login"). You'll see users of the Plumwick app getting bounced to the sign-in screen even though their refresh token looks valid. Root cause is a clock-skew check in the Gatewright auth service that's a bit too strict. Quick fix: bump the skew tolerance flag and restart the token pods — users recover on their next request. Don't rotate the signing key; that makes it worse. Step-by-step instructions with screenshots are on the internal page below.

runbook for badug-kadup: https://confluence.zemvarlabs.internal/projects/browse/display/projects/bd1b

Handover — inventory reconciliation job (Tallyharbor). Review the diff on the mismatch-threshold change before approving; I lowered it from 2% to 0.5% after last week's phantom-stock incident. Job runs hourly; dry-run flag is still on in staging. Known quirk: negative counts from the Kestrel warehouse feed are clamped, not rejected — flagged in a TODO. If the job's sealed config store locks after three bad auths, recover it with the phrase below.

strongbox words: zorwyn-sorael-belion-ulaius-silmir-ulays-briax-rusdor-gorix

TURN-208: Gatevale turnstile counters at the Merrow Field pilot double-count when a rotation reverses mid-cycle. Attendance totals drift roughly 2% high per event. The debounce window fix is implemented, reviewed by Ilsa, and soak-tested across two simulated match days without drift. Ready for your cut; the candidate build is identified below.

trace token, tagag-tafog: htk6_5ed18c

## Replica Lag Alarm

If the Quillbase read-replica lag alarm fires during a release, pause the rollout and check replication throughput on the ledger shard. Lag under 90 seconds usually self-resolves; above that, fail reads over to the primary. Once lag clears, resume the pipeline and re-sign the deploy manifest with the key below.

release key, kawif-hawep: bky13_X7TGuRG4Zu4ZJ